I found a wonderful substitute. I don't have it in front of me so I can't quote the ingrediants. Ken's steakhouse marinade in mesquite flavor. This is a spicy mesquite marinade that is thick in consistancy. It's 3gr carbs per serving. Its not sweet at all. I found that if you sprinkle a little splenda in this is tastes and feels just like mesquite bbq sauce.
